diff --git a/google-cloud-logging/pom.xml b/google-cloud-logging/pom.xml
index 0f4190bfa..b514c8503 100644
--- a/google-cloud-logging/pom.xml
+++ b/google-cloud-logging/pom.xml
@@ -157,6 +157,28 @@
opentelemetry-sdk-trace
test
+
+
+
+
+
+
+
+
+ io.opentelemetry
+ opentelemetry-semconv
+ test
+
+
+ io.opentelemetry
+ opentelemetry-sdk-common
+ test
+
+
+ com.google.cloud.opentelemetry
+ exporter-trace
+ test
+
diff --git a/google-cloud-logging/src/test/java/com/google/cloud/logging/ContextTest.java b/google-cloud-logging/src/test/java/com/google/cloud/logging/ContextTest.java
index b2b3ea17a..7ef8f90de 100644
--- a/google-cloud-logging/src/test/java/com/google/cloud/logging/ContextTest.java
+++ b/google-cloud-logging/src/test/java/com/google/cloud/logging/ContextTest.java
@@ -169,7 +169,7 @@ public void testParsingOpenTelemetryContext() {
OpenTelemetrySdk.builder()
.setTracerProvider(
SdkTracerProvider.builder().addSpanProcessor(inMemorySpanProcessor).build())
- .build();
+ .buildAndRegisterGlobal();
Tracer tracer = openTelemetrySdk.getTracer("ContextTest");
Span otelSpan = tracer.spanBuilder("Example Span Attributes").startSpan();
diff --git a/pom.xml b/pom.xml
index 7915f66fd..a1359a7ec 100644
--- a/pom.xml
+++ b/pom.xml
@@ -54,7 +54,6 @@
UTF-8
github
google-cloud-logging-parent
- 1.37.0
@@ -62,14 +61,21 @@
io.opentelemetry
- opentelemetry-api
- ${opentelemetry.version}
-
-
- io.opentelemetry
- opentelemetry-context
- ${opentelemetry.version}
+ opentelemetry-bom
+ 1.38.0
+ pom
+ import
+
+
+
+
+
+
+
+
+
+
com.google.api.grpc
@@ -130,37 +136,47 @@
-
-
- io.opentelemetry
- opentelemetry-sdk
- ${opentelemetry.version}
- test
-
-
- io.opentelemetry
- opentelemetry-sdk-testing
- ${opentelemetry.version}
- test
-
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
io.opentelemetry
opentelemetry-semconv
- ${opentelemetry.version}-alpha
- test
-
-
- io.opentelemetry
- opentelemetry-sdk-trace
- ${opentelemetry.version}
- test
-
-
- io.opentelemetry
- opentelemetry-sdk-common
- ${opentelemetry.version}
+ 1.1.0-alpha
test
+
+
+
+
+
+
+
+
+
+
+
+
com.google.cloud.opentelemetry
exporter-trace